<B>Teapot Dome Scandal Pinback.</B></I> This symbolic 1 1/2" button shows crossed oil cans superimposed over a lidded teapot. It reads, "We Demand Farm Relief No More Teapot Domes". Some staining on the face with light rusting on the back. Fine condition. Harding's Secretary of the Interior, Albert B. Hall, received enormous kickbacks and interest-free loans for opening public oil reserves to the oil companies. An investigation of Hall's activities commenced in 1922 and resulted in an affair named after the Teapot Dome reserve in Wyoming. Unfortunately for Harding, Hall's unethical behavior would forever cast a pall of corruption over the entire administration.<BR><BR><b>Shipping:</b> Small Collectibles (<a target="_blank" href="http://www.heritageauctions.com/common/shipping.php">view shipping information</a>) <BR><BR><B>Important notice
